Bonjour j’essai d’intégrer un capteur airthings via un module. C’est du BLE.
Le module m’annonce une erreure :
‹ Failed while searching for devices. Is a bluetooth adapter available? If the watchdog option is enabled, this addon will restart and try again. ›
Je cherche a vérifier que mon Bluetooth/Ble fonctionne correctement, comment puis je faire pour m’en assurer ?
Dans mes souvenirs, il faut rentrer l’adresse MAC de l’appareil directement dans la config.
Après je ne sais as du tout si l’on peut scanner la présence de devices via Home assistant OS, car les commandes HACItool ou Bluetotthctl ne marche pas.
Vois tu l’appareil via le BLE de ton tel ?
Peux-tu nous donner la dénomination de l’appareil complet ?
Merci de ton aide,
J’ai bien le devise visible sur Windows via un « bluetooth le explorer » et le capteurs est bien dispo via bluetooth avec l’appli airthings :
J’ai son adresse MAC :
En faite je ne comprend pas pourquoi le connecter directement en bluetooth, je ne pense pas que tu puisses récupérer les infos juste en le connectant en bluetooth.
en faite l’integration bluetooth est censé fonctionner il y en a même 2 autres qui le permette. Je pense que c’est mon Bluetooth/ble qui bug, d’où ma question j’aurais bien aimé le tester avec autre chose (un smartphone ?) pour être sur qu’il marche correctement.
je n’ai pas cette commande dispo via ssh sur home assistant mais j’ai :
[bluetooth]# show
Controller B8:27:EB:E3:77:15 (public)
Name: homeassistant
Alias: homeassistant
Class: 0x00000000
Powered: no
Discoverable: no
DiscoverableTimeout: 0x000000b4
Pairable: no
UUID: Generic Attribute Profile (00001801-0000-1000-8000-00805f9b34fb)
UUID: Generic Access Profile (00001800-0000-1000-8000-00805f9b34fb)
UUID: Headset (00001108-0000-1000-8000-00805f9b34fb)
UUID: PnP Information (00001200-0000-1000-8000-00805f9b34fb)
UUID: Headset AG (00001112-0000-1000-8000-00805f9b34fb)
UUID: Device Information (0000180a-0000-1000-8000-00805f9b34fb)
Modalias: usb:v1D6Bp0246d053E
Discovering: no
Roles: central
Roles: peripheral
Advertising Features:
ActiveInstances: 0x00 (0)
SupportedInstances: 0x05 (5)
SupportedIncludes: tx-power
SupportedIncludes: appearance
SupportedIncludes: local-name
[bluetooth]# power on
Failed to set power on: org.bluez.Error.Busy
C’est ce qui fait dire que mon bluetooth n’est pas au top j’ai déjà réussi a scanner mais la plus part du temps j’ai cette erreur
Le probleme c’est qu’en ssh sur « Home Assistant command line » je n’ai pas accès a ces commandes ,…
Là j’arrive a scan et j’ai bien mes devices. J’arrive a avoir une premier liste avant que les commandes soient bogués et je n’arrive pas a déterminer quand le bug apparait pour le moment.
Ext ce qu’il existe un endroit dans homeassistant pour voir le(s) controleurs bluetooth dans home assistant,… par exemple dans* « parametre>systeme>Materiel> …Tout le materiel » ?
J’ai trouver un vieux dongle bluetooth de souris et c’est bon le bluetooth fonctionne,… J’ai mon Airthings
Le bluetooth du rpi3 est pas au top apparemment…
Non.la gestion du bluetooth via HA n’est pas super, c’est piur cela sue je suis passé par des esp32 a différents endroit pour faire un bon maillage BLE.
Tu aurais un exemple quelque part de cette méthode ?
J’ai pas tout compris a esphome encore, l’intégration peu se servir directement du bluetooth d’un Raspberry ?